
With our Accredited Vocational Nursing program you will be prepared for the ever changing field of nursing and healthcare. Placed in a lecture style classroom you will learn a variety of different nursing topics, from fundamental principles and practices of nursing to anatomy and physiology, infection control, asepsis and patient care skills. As you learn the fundementals, you will also recieve on hand clinical training to prepare you with real life situations. When you’ve finished all the coursework and passed the final exam, you’ll be prepared to take the National Council Licensure Examination (NCLEX-PN) for licensure as a vocational nurse meeting the standards set by the Board of Vocational Nursing and Psychiatric Technicians.
What are some Career opportunities?
Vocational Nurses work in a variety of healthcare settings. When you’ve become licensed, you may choose to work in facilities such as: • Hospitals • Longterm care facilities • Home health agencies • Rehabilitation centers Where ever you choose to work, becoming a Vocational Nurse gives you the opportunity to help people and continually expand your horizons.
